Dental implants have become a focus in modern dentistry, providing a reliable answer for those dealing with tooth loss. Among the multiple benefits they provide, one vital side value contemplating is their impact on adjacent teeth. Understanding how dental implants have an result on surrounding teeth aids in making informed selections about oral health.
When a tooth is misplaced, neighboring teeth can easily shift towards the house left behind. This movement can result in misalignment, which compromises the overall chew and performance of the mouth. Dental implants mimic natural tooth roots, thereby maintaining the position of adjacent teeth.

The stability supplied by an implant is crucial, as it helps in preserving not simply the physical alignment but additionally the structural integrity of the jawbone. When a tooth is missing, the underlying bone can start to deteriorate because of lack of stimulation. An implant exerts stress on the bone during chewing, much like a natural tooth, which promotes bone health.
In some cases, a bridge or partial denture could also be thought-about as a substitute for implants. While these options may restore some performance, they can place further stress on neighboring teeth. Bridges normally require filing down the encompassing teeth to accommodate the anchors, thereby affecting their health over time. Dental implants, then again, do not alter existing teeth, making them a more conservative selection.

Hygiene becomes another crucial issue when contemplating adjacent teeth in the context of implants. With dental implants, the individual can keep a daily hygiene routine much like natural teeth. Flossing and brushing across the implant are straightforward, ensuring that the gum tissue remains healthy and minimizing the danger of gum disease that might adversely have an result on adjacent teeth.
Moreover, the materials used in dental implants are biocompatible. This means they are designed to combine properly with the physique, reducing the chances of an antagonistic reaction. This attribute not solely makes the implant secure but additionally protects close by teeth from potential points that might come up because of contamination or infection.
In phrases of aesthetics, dental implants supply a natural feel and appear, closely resembling original teeth. Adjacent teeth benefit from this aesthetic appeal as well. When an implant is placed, the surrounding gum tissue can be shaped to mimic natural contours, thereby enhancing the overall appearance of the smile. This aesthetic factor can encourage people to invest in their oral care routines, benefiting each the implants and adjacent teeth in the long term.
